What are your professional milestones?

I started out with a degree in sociology and psychology and then soon moved on to work in sports management to be Communication Manager and head of communication of the International Fencing Federation. It was not a fulfilling position, but I learned a lot about business and management there.

When I realized that this position did not suit me anymore, I changed career paths to become a certified mindfulness and self-leadership trainer and coach. To me, this means loving what I do for a living. It is just wonderful to see people find their innate calmness, clarity and confidence to navigate their lives.

So I can say that every step in my career – my studies, my first jobs, my decision to become a trainer & coach – is important, because it has led me to where and who I am now.

What do you recommend to applicants for the Femtec Career-Building Programme?

Normally, don’t give advice. Because I believe that you are the expert in your own life and have your reasons to the your life the way you do.
If I look back on my own path, four learnings stand out:

It is ok to make mistakes.

Be open. Everything is an opportunity.

Do your inner work. It makes life much easier.

Doubts are just thoughts, even if they sound very true. Especially self-doubts.
